Understanding Typhoons

Before diving into the specifics of recent typhoons in China, it's essential to understand what these storms are and how they form. Typhoons are essentially the same as hurricanes and cyclones; the name simply varies by geographic location. They are characterized by a low-pressure center, known as the eye, around which winds spiral inward. The intensity of a typhoon is measured by its sustained wind speed, and they are categorized using scales like the Saffir-Simpson Hurricane Wind Scale. These storms develop over warm ocean waters, typically near the equator, where the warm, moist air rises and creates a rotating system. The Coriolis effect, caused by the Earth's rotation, influences the direction of the spin – counterclockwise in the Northern Hemisphere and clockwise in the Southern Hemisphere.

Formation and Characteristics

The formation of a typhoon is a complex process. It begins with a tropical disturbance, an area of low pressure with thunderstorms. If the sea surface temperature is warm enough (at least 26.5°C or 80°F), and the atmospheric conditions are favorable, the disturbance can strengthen. As the warm, moist air rises, it cools and condenses, releasing latent heat. This heat further warms the air, causing it to rise even faster and creating a feedback loop. The rising air creates an area of low pressure at the surface, drawing in more air and intensifying the storm. The storm's rotation is driven by the Coriolis effect, and as the storm intensifies, it develops a distinct eye – a region of calm at the center. The eyewall, the area surrounding the eye, contains the storm's strongest winds and heaviest rainfall. Typhoons can vary in size, from relatively small storms with a diameter of a few hundred kilometers to massive systems spanning over a thousand kilometers. Their intensity is determined by factors such as sea surface temperature, wind shear (changes in wind speed or direction with height), and atmospheric stability. Common Impacts of Typhoons

Typhoons can have devastating impacts on the regions they strike. The most immediate threat is the strong winds, which can cause widespread damage to buildings, infrastructure, and vegetation. Roofs can be torn off, trees uprooted, and power lines downed, leading to widespread power outages. Heavy rainfall is another significant hazard, often leading to flooding, landslides, and mudslides. Coastal areas are particularly vulnerable to storm surges, which are abnormal rises in sea level caused by the storm's winds pushing water towards the shore. Storm surges can inundate low-lying areas, causing extensive damage to property and infrastructure, and can also lead to loss of life. In addition to the immediate physical damage, typhoons can also have long-term economic and social impacts. Businesses may be forced to close, disrupting supply chains and impacting livelihoods. Agricultural areas can be devastated, leading to food shortages and economic hardship for farmers. The displacement of communities can also put a strain on resources and infrastructure, and the psychological impact of experiencing a major storm can be significant. Notable Typhoons in Recent Years

In recent years, China has experienced several significant typhoons that have caused widespread damage and disruption. Typhoon Lekima in 2019 was one of the most impactful, making landfall in Zhejiang province with sustained winds of over 200 kilometers per hour. It brought torrential rainfall and caused widespread flooding, resulting in significant economic losses and displacement of communities. Typhoon Hagibis, also in 2019, although primarily impacting Japan, had indirect effects on China, contributing to heavy rainfall and flooding in some areas. In 2020, Typhoon Haishen brought strong winds and heavy rainfall to northeastern China, impacting agricultural areas and causing power outages. More recently, in 2021, Typhoon In-fa made landfall in Zhejiang, bringing heavy rainfall and causing flooding in several cities. These are just a few examples of the many typhoons that have affected China in recent years. Each storm presents unique challenges, and authorities and communities must remain vigilant and prepared. Government Initiatives and Infrastructure Development

The Chinese government has implemented numerous initiatives to mitigate the impacts of typhoons and enhance preparedness. These initiatives include investments in infrastructure development, such as the construction of seawalls, dikes, and drainage systems to protect coastal areas from storm surges and flooding. The government has also invested in improving weather forecasting and early warning systems, using advanced technologies such as satellite imagery and radar to track typhoons and provide timely warnings to the public. In addition, the government has implemented regulations and building codes to ensure that buildings are constructed to withstand strong winds and heavy rainfall. Furthermore, the government has established emergency response plans and procedures to coordinate rescue and relief efforts in the event of a typhoon. These plans include the deployment of emergency personnel, the provision of shelter and supplies, and the evacuation of vulnerable populations.
